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to protect them from floodwaters, rising sea levels, or other environmental concerns. The process typically includes lifting the entire building and its foundation to a higher elevation, often using specialized equipment and techniques. Once elevated, the property is secured on a new, stable foundation, which can help prevent future flood damage and extend the lifespan of the structure. Building raising is a strategic solution for homeowners seeking to adapt their properties to changing environmental conditions without the need for complete reconstruction.
This service addresses common problems related to flood risk, water damage, and property loss. Properties located in flood-prone areas often face restrictions or increased insurance costs, making raising a building a practical option to mitigate these issues. Additionally, building raising can help preserve historic structures or properties with sentimental value that might otherwise be vulnerable to environmental threats. By elevating the structure, property owners can reduce the likelihood of flood-related damage and potentially lower insurance premiums, offering a long-term protective measure.
Building raising services are frequently used for residential properties, especially single-family homes situated in flood zones or low-lying regions. Commercial buildings, including small businesses and retail spaces, may also benefit from this process if they are at risk of flooding. The technique can be applied to various types of properties, from traditional wood-frame houses to larger, more complex structures. The suitability largely depends on the property's design, foundation type, and local environmental conditions, making consultation with experienced service providers essential to determine the best approach.

The overview below groups typical Building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Berwyn, IL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Inspection and Preparation - Costs for inspecting and preparing a site typically range from $1,000 to $3,000, depending on the property's size and condition. Examples include assessing the foundation and clearing the area for raising services.
Building Raising Equipment and Materials - Expenses for materials and equipment can vary from $2,500 to $7,000, influenced by the building's height and weight. Heavier structures or taller buildings tend to increase costs.
Labor and Contracting Services - Labor costs generally fall between $4,000 and $12,000, based on the project's complexity and local rates. More intricate or larger projects may require additional skilled labor.
Permits and Additional Fees - Permit and inspection fees typically range from $500 to $2,000, depending on local regulations and project scope. These costs are essential for compliance and successful completion.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
